Kafka

Monitora Apache Kafka con Prometheus e Grafana

Monitora Apache Kafka con Prometheus e Grafana
  1. Come posso monitorare Kafka con Grafana?
  2. Come posso monitorare Kafka con Prometheus?
  3. Può Prometeo leggere da Kafka?
  4. Cosa posso monitorare con Kafka?
  5. Cos'è l'origine dati Grafana?
  6. Esiste un'interfaccia utente per Kafka?
  7. Cos'è il server Prometheus?
  8. Cos'è la coda Kafka?
  9. Come funziona l'esportatore Kafka?
  10. Cos'è l'esportatore Prometheus JMX?
  11. Qual è l'esportatore Kafka?
  12. Come posso controllare la latenza di Kafka?
  13. Cosa rende Kafka così veloce?
  14. Come posso monitorare il ritardo di Kafka?

Come posso monitorare Kafka con Grafana?

Importa il file JSON su Grafana per ottenere la dashboard Panoramica di Kafka. Su Grafana, fai clic su Dashboard, poi su Home e infine su Importa e importa il file JSON.

Come posso monitorare Kafka con Prometheus?

Per configurare il server Prometheus per eseguire lo scraping del broker Kafka:

  1. Accedi al server Prometheus utilizzando SSH.
  2. Eseguire il comando seguente per vedere dove Prometheus sta leggendo il file di configurazione: ps -ef | grep prometeo. ...
  3. Modificare il file di configurazione e aggiungere un nuovo "lavoro" per il polling del server Prometheus.

Può Prometeo leggere da Kafka?

Avvio veloce. In questo Quick Start, configuri il connettore sink Kafka Connect Prometheus Metrics per leggere i record dagli argomenti Kafka e renderli accessibili da un endpoint del server HTTP. Prometheus quindi raschia l'endpoint del server.

Cosa posso monitorare con Kafka?

Le 10 principali metriche di Kafka su cui concentrarsi per prime

Cos'è l'origine dati Grafana?

Origine dei dati

I plug-in delle origini dati comunicano con fonti esterne di dati e restituiscono i dati in un formato comprensibile da Grafana. ... Utilizza i plug-in dell'origine dati quando desideri importare dati da sistemi esterni.

Esiste un'interfaccia utente per Kafka?

Kafka Tool è un'applicazione GUI per la gestione e l'utilizzo dei cluster Apache Kafka. Fornisce un'interfaccia utente intuitiva che consente di visualizzare rapidamente gli oggetti all'interno di un cluster Kafka così come i messaggi archiviati negli argomenti del cluster. ... Utilizzando Kafka Tool, puoi: Visualizzare le metriche a livello di cluster, broker, argomento e consumatore.

Cos'è il server Prometheus?

Prometheus è un toolkit di monitoraggio e avviso di sistemi open source originariamente creato su SoundCloud. ... Ora è un progetto open source autonomo e gestito indipendentemente da qualsiasi azienda.

Cos'è la coda Kafka?

Kafka come coda

Un argomento Kafka è suddiviso in unità chiamate partizioni per tolleranza agli errori e scalabilità. I gruppi di consumatori consentono a Kafka di comportarsi come una coda, poiché ogni istanza di consumatore in un gruppo elabora i dati da un insieme di partizioni non sovrapposte (all'interno di un argomento Kafka).

Come funziona l'esportatore Kafka?

JMX Exporter è un raccoglitore che può essere eseguito come parte di un'applicazione Java esistente (come Kafka) ed esporre le sue metriche JMX su un endpoint HTTP, che può essere utilizzato da qualsiasi sistema come Prometheus.

Cos'è l'esportatore Prometheus JMX?

Monitoraggio delle applicazioni Java con l'esportatore Prometheus JMX e Grafana. ... Questo è il lavoro dell'esportatore Prometheus JMX. L'esportatore si connette al sistema di raccolta metriche nativo di Java, Java Management Extensions (JMX) e converte le metriche in un formato comprensibile da Prometheus.

Qual è l'esportatore Kafka?

Kafka Exporter è un progetto open source per migliorare il monitoraggio dei broker e dei clienti Apache Kafka. Kafka Exporter viene fornito con AMQ Streams per la distribuzione con un cluster Kafka per estrarre dati di metriche aggiuntivi dai broker Kafka relativi a offset, gruppi di consumatori, ritardo dei consumatori e argomenti.

Come posso controllare la latenza di Kafka?

Come misurare la latenza. Dal momento che Kafka 0.10, i messaggi Kafka contengono un timestamp. Questo timestamp può essere assegnato dal produttore o è assegnato dal broker se non ne viene fornito nessuno. Confrontando i timestamp nell'argomento di output con i timestamp nell'argomento di input, possiamo misurare la latenza di elaborazione.

Cosa rende Kafka così veloce?

Kafka utilizza molte altre tecniche oltre a quelle sopra menzionate per rendere i sistemi molto più veloci ed efficienti: batch di dati per ridurre le chiamate di rete e anche convertire molte scritture casuali in scritture sequenziali. Compressione di batch (e non di singoli messaggi) utilizzando i codec LZ4, SNAPPY o GZIP.

Come posso monitorare il ritardo di Kafka?

Il modo più semplice per controllare gli offset e il ritardo di un determinato gruppo di consumatori è utilizzare gli strumenti CLI forniti con Kafka. Nel diagramma sopra, puoi vedere i dettagli su un gruppo di consumatori chiamato my-group . L'output del comando mostra i dettagli per partizione all'interno dell'argomento.

Come installare Apache Subversion su Ubuntu 18.04 LTS
Come installare Apache Subversion su Ubuntu 18.04 Prerequisiti. Una nuova Ubuntu 18.04 VPS sull'Atlantico.Net Cloud Platform. ... Passaggio 1 creare A...
Come installare Apache Web Server su Ubuntu 18.10
Come installo e configuro il server Web Apache su Ubuntu? Come avvio Apache su Ubuntu? Come faccio a scaricare e installare un server Apache? Come apr...
Come installare il software tramite Flatpak su Debian 10
Come installo le app con Flatpak? Come installo le app Flatpak su Debian? Come installo i programmi su Debian? Come installo manualmente un programma ...